You should not use images to convey your most important information. Most modern email clients, especially those that are web-based, do not automatically display images in emails. This could possibly make for ugly messages or ones that are unreadable if they rely too much on images. Always use clear text for the most important information you want to convey, and use descriptive alt tags for any images that you do use.

You never want your business to be accused of spamming. One way to avoid this is to give consumers an opportunity to confirm their desire to opt-in to your emails. Let them verify that they want to subscribe by confirming their email address. Put two links inside the email, one that allows the contact to agree to the subscription and another that lets them opt out of it. That way, no one can say that your emails are spam, and your customers will trust you to treat them professionally.

A/B testing could be helpful with a mobile landing page. This will help you test which strategies work and which ones don’t, which is as crucial to mobile site development as it is to creating standard web pages. For the test, create two separate versions of your mobile landing page–one is A, and one is B–and determine which is more effective for converting customers. Move forward with the most successful of the two.

Get involved with a picture-to-screen campaign. This type of campaign enables users to take a photo on a mobile phone. The customer will then text this photo and a certain code to a number you provide. These two things together will cause the picture to be posted on a specific webpage or screening. The photos that are received can be shown on a television monitor or digital billboards.

Try your mobile marketing materials on a wide variety of mobile devices to ensure that your message is always clear and accessible. There are a variety of different mobile browsers, and each device has a different screen size and resolution. The way your website and advertisements appear may vary, depending on the device used to access or view them. At the very least, be sure to test them out on all the popular mobile devices.
